As some people have already found out, there's a plan afoot at the moment to re-release the first Million Dead album, "A Song To Ruin", sometime before the end of this year, with the fabled live DVD that never was. The guys at Xtra Mile have decided it's time, and some legal disputes have been cleared up to everyone's satisfaction, so it looks like this is actually going to happen. I don't have a date yet. I'm pretty happy about this - that record is totally out of print, and personally I prefer it (marginally) to "Harmony No Harmony".
